Alternatives to overmolding

Hello all,

I am lead development designer for a new cosmetics packaging (compacts, bottles lipsticks etc)for a very high profile fashion house. The core concept of the the look we have been directed to acheive is a clear acrylic shell with a colored inner wall that shows through from the inside. To acheive this effect, the best way we know is to overmold the two layers and so all design direction for tooling has been to this end. However, the tooling costs that we are recieving from our candidate manufacturers are a little prohibitive. Therefore, I would very much appreciate some input into alternative processes to achaive the colored inner wall effect.

So far, we have considered: spraying - ruled out because hard to control

Separate moldings then inserted: ruled out because fused effect of two materials against each as seen from outside can not be achieve due to reflection from inside surface of acrylic- Any methods to reduce reflection?

insert molding: a form of overmolding, we will proably use in some cases because cheaper methodology but still bond between surfaces can lack integrity

Cubic transfer: won't work because concave area is to be coloured

Our first year production requirements will be @ 100,000 pieces.

Looks to me as though your alternative forms of manufactue would be more expensive than overmoulding. We use Chinese sources for our overmoulded parts (Instrument Cases) and have found that both part and tooling costs are quite reasonable. I should add that our quantities are at around 1/10th of your estimated annual production.

Insert molding can be designed very strong. Perhaps a mechanical feature can be designed in to hold the over-mold better?

Perhaps you can blow-mold the colored part into the transparent acrylic shell?
